Junie B. Jones The Musical JR. is a popular, high-energy show for young performers that requires authorized scripts from Music Theatre International (MTI). The show follows the relatable, comedic adventures of a first-grader navigating new friendships, school, and growing up. The musical is designed for a flexible, large youth cast, making it an ideal, accessible choice for schools.

Some school districts or public libraries have purchased performance kits. Ask your librarian or drama department if they already own a licensed copy of the script.
